  • SUMMARY
  • Organic chemistry – definition, organic compounds and its classification.
  • General formula, molecular formula, structural formula, reactions undergone and reactivity of alkanes, alkenes, alkynes.
  • Preparation, properties and uses of –
  1. Alkanes
  2. Alkenes
  3. Alkynes
  4. Alcohol, aldehydes, carboxylic acids.
